Sonim’s Indestructable Mobile Phone Destroyed!

A little late I know but back at The Gadget Show Live, we managed to get a sneaky video demonstration from the staff at the Sonim stand on how they claimst_header_logo2 their phones are “indestructable”. The phones were the new XP3 Enduro’s.

For the public, there were several work benches set up around the Sonim stand with hammers on them so that the passing public could physically hit the phones to check out their indestructable qualities. Little did we know that while we were recording, a passer by had a go bashing the hammer and seemingly broke the phone.

And there you have it, Sonim’s claims that their phones are “indestructable” ring true as in the video it first looks like the man has actually been able to break the phone and let me tell you, those hammers were very real hammers capable of breaking most things. However, apart from a crack in the screen and the temporary cut-off, the phone is still in working condition and he even phones me to check!

So if your on the look out for an indestructable mobile phone i.e. if your working in a very heavy labour job then i’d say get your hands on one of these, because they are as close to indestructable as phones can possibly be.
